陣列元素的遍歷,在c++中可用兩種方法簡單實現,舉例如下:
新建乙個win32的控制台應用程式,輸入如下**:
#include "stdafx.h"
#include
using namespace std;
int main(int argc, char* argv)
; //定義陣列
int i=null;
//通過下標來遍歷
cout<<"\n"<<"通過下標來遍歷陣列:\n";
for (i=0;i<5;++i)
return 0;
}必須使用命名空間std
否則會提示cout未宣告的符號
陣列名即代表陣列首位址,即陣列第乙個元素的記憶體位址
陣列各元素的記憶體位址是連續的,所以可以進行加減,跨度為單個元素所佔的記憶體大小
遍歷陣列元素
遍歷陣列元素也就是把每個元素輸出出來.第一種語法 foreach arr as val ue value value value是自己定義的,陣列中每個元素的值給val ue,然 後輸出第 二種語法 for each value,然後輸出 第二種語法 foreach value,然後輸出 第二種語 ...
遍歷陣列元素
遍歷陣列經常使用的是foreach語法結構 foreach 語法結構提供了遍歷陣列的簡單方式。foreach 僅能夠應用於陣列和物件。如果嘗試應用於其他資料型別的變數,或者未初始化的變數將發出錯誤資訊。foreach有兩種語法 foreach array expression as value st...
二維陣列元素遍歷與陣列元素累加和
學習完了陣列元素的訪問,學習下陣列的遍歷及陣列的元素累加和操作。class arraydemo09 int sum 0 for int i 0 i sum arr i system.out.println sum sum system.out.println 二維陣列的求累加和並遍歷 int arr...